Stock Track | ANI Pharmaceuticals Soars 17% on Record Q2 Results and Raised 2025 Guidance

Stock Track
08/08

Shares of ANI Pharmaceuticals (ANIP) surged 17.03% in pre-market trading on Friday following the company's announcement of record second-quarter 2025 financial results and an upward revision of its full-year 2025 guidance. The strong performance and optimistic outlook have sparked significant investor enthusiasm, driving the stock's substantial gain.

ANI Pharmaceuticals reported a Q2 2025 adjusted earnings per share (EPS) of $1.80, handily beating the analyst estimate of $1.39. The company's Q2 revenue reached $211.371 million, surpassing the expected $187.797 million. This impressive performance demonstrates ANI's strong market position and effective execution of its business strategy across its rare disease, brands, and generics portfolios.

Key highlights from the quarterly results include: - Record quarterly net revenues of $211.4 million, representing year-over-year growth of 53.1% - Rare Disease quarterly net revenues of $104.0 million, including Cortrophin Gel net revenues of $81.6 million, an increase of 66.0% year-over-year - Generics quarterly net revenues of $90.3 million, an increase of 22.1% year-over-year - Record quarterly adjusted non-GAAP EBITDA of $54.1 million, an increase of 62.8% year-over-year

Adding to the positive sentiment, ANI Pharmaceuticals significantly raised its full-year 2025 guidance. The company now expects net revenues in the range of $818-$843 million, up from previous estimates of $768-$793 million and exceeding the analyst consensus of $791.5 million. Additionally, the adjusted EPS outlook for 2025 has been increased to $6.98-$7.35, surpassing the previous guidance of $6.27-$6.62 and the analyst estimate of $6.53.

Nikhil Lalwani, President and CEO of ANI, commented on the results: "We had another record-setting quarter for our Company, with all-time highs in net revenue, adjusted EBITDA, and adjusted EPS, reflecting very strong momentum across our business units. Our Rare Disease team delivered exceptional sequential and year-over-year quarterly growth with Cortrophin Gel, driving prescription demand and new patient starts to new highs."

The company's strong performance was driven by growth across multiple segments, including its rare disease portfolio, generics business, and brands. The success of Cortrophin Gel, ANI's lead rare disease asset, and the expansion of its generics business through new product launches and operational excellence have contributed significantly to the company's robust financial results.
